Manish Khanna is a scholar working on Surgery, Genetics and Epidemiology. According to data from OpenAlex, Manish Khanna has authored 66 papers receiving a total of 697 indexed citations (citations by other indexed papers that have themselves been cited), including 23 papers in Surgery, 18 papers in Genetics and 14 papers in Epidemiology. Recurrent topics in Manish Khanna's work include Mesenchymal stem cell research (16 papers), Periodontal Regeneration and Treatments (12 papers) and Osteoarthritis Treatment and Mechanisms (11 papers). Manish Khanna is often cited by papers focused on Mesenchymal stem cell research (16 papers), Periodontal Regeneration and Treatments (12 papers) and Osteoarthritis Treatment and Mechanisms (11 papers). Manish Khanna collaborates with scholars based in India, Canada and United States. Manish Khanna's co-authors include Madhan Jeyaraman, Sathish Muthu, Naveen Jeyaraman, Bruce R. Smoller, Annett Körner, Scott M. Dinehart, Prakash Gangadaran, Ramya Lakshmi Rajendran, Rashmi Jain and Arulkumar Nallakumarasamy and has published in prestigious journals such as The American Journal of Gastroenterology, Experimental Cell Research and Journal of the American Academy of Dermatology.
